file-type

华为OD机考攻略:高效刷题与备考技巧

DOCX文件

下载需积分: 1 | 21KB | 更新于2024-08-03 | 64 浏览量 | 1 下载量 举报 收藏
download 立即下载
"华为 OD 机考攻略_加强版" 华为的在线开发者测试(OD)是一项评估程序员算法能力的重要环节,其机考部分主要侧重于数据结构和算法的应用。本攻略针对这一考试形式提供了宝贵的建议,旨在帮助考生更好地准备和应对考试。 首先,机考包含三道算法题目,难度梯度设定为两道简单题和一道中等难度题,总分为400分。考试平台是牛客网,因此考生需要熟悉该平台的操作,特别是输入输出的处理方式。考试期间,摄像头必须开启,以防止任何可能被视为作弊的行为,同时考生应避免离开座位或频繁移动头部。 面对机考,有几点刷题和复习策略值得采纳: 1. 遇到难题时,不要过分纠结。初期遇到不熟悉的题目是正常现象。这时,可以参考答案区的解决方案,理解并记忆解题思路,随后在隔一天和第五天分别重新做题,以加深记忆并整理出题目的通用解题模板。 2. 针对多种解法的题目,建议挑选那些独特而高效的方法进行学习,但也要根据题目出现的频率来决定优先级。例如,对于高频题型,应当掌握其典型解法。 3. 牛客网和LeetCode都是优秀的刷题平台,各有优势。由于实际机考在牛客网举行,即使平时更倾向于LeetCode,也应在牛客网上练习高频题型,熟悉其输入输出格式。牛客网的“华为考题”专题和按知识点过滤的功能可以帮助针对性训练;而LeetCode则可以按标签筛选题目。 4. 切记在练习中养成编写输入输出的习惯。尽管一些牛客题目可能不要求输入输出,但在实际机考中,这一步骤是必需的,特别是对于涉及数据结构如二叉树的题目,构造输入输出会更复杂,需要额外的练习。 总结来说,成功通过华为OD机考的关键在于持续练习,掌握不同题型的通用解题策略,熟悉考试平台,以及适时参考高质量的解答。通过遵循遗忘曲线规律重复练习,理解并记忆解题思路,将大大提高考试表现。在练习过程中,要注意输入输出的编写,尤其是对于复杂数据结构的题目,以确保在正式考试时能顺利解决此类问题。

相关推荐

学长爱编程
  • 粉丝: 1927
上传资源 快速赚钱